English meaning
Senses
竜 is used for these senses in English:
- Chinese dragon (mythology) A legendary creature, usually depicted as long and snake-like, with many claws, common in several East Asian cultures.
- dragon In European mythologies, a gigantic beast, typically reptilian with leathery bat-like wings, lion-like claws, scaly skin and a serpent-like body, often a monster with fiery breath.
- naga (Indian mythology) A member of a class of semi-divine creatures, often taking the form of a very large snake and associated with water.
dragon — full definition
- noun A mythical, usually giant reptilian creature, often depicted breathing fire and guarding treasure in Western folklore.
- noun In East Asian mythology, a long, serpentine, generally benevolent creature associated with power and good fortune.
- noun (Informal) A fierce, intimidating woman.
naga — full definition
- noun In Hindu and Buddhist mythology, a semi-divine being that takes the form of a great serpent, often linked to water and the underworld.
- noun A fantasy or fictional creature with a human or humanoid upper body and a serpent's lower body.
